Join Joe Barnard, a church leader and author, as he explores the cultural shift drawing young men toward faith. He discusses the importance of pre-evangelism through influencers and podcasts, and how churches can welcome newcomers by addressing moral questions. Barnard highlights the unique challenges men face today, including fatherlessness and confusion around masculinity, while offering practical questions to spark meaningful conversations. His insights remind us of the power of the gospel in navigating modern complexities.

Pre-Evangelized Young Men Are Showing Up
- Young men are increasingly 'pre-evangelized' by cultural figures and online content before they arrive at church.
- This shifts evangelism: men often arrive curious and primed for deeper questions about meaning and purpose.
Coach Surprised By Christian Book Interest
- Joe watched a basketball coach light up when he saw a Christian book, contradicting expectations.
- Such moments show unexpected receptivity to religious material in everyday settings.
Low Tide Reveals Christian Foundations
- Cultural instability and a loss of assumed moral anchors are driving people backward toward transcendent resources.
- Low tide reveals the Christian foundations beneath modern norms, creating fresh curiosity about the gospel.
